Spring into Summer 2024

Online registration is now available on theFOAT.com Mustangs Northwest’s traditional car season opener is the Spring into Summer car show at Remlinger Farms in beautiful Carnation, Washington. Spring into Summer takes place May 11, 2024, 8 AM to 3 PM. This is a judged car show for Mustangs using modified Mustang Club of America (MCA)… Read more »

Veterans Day Parade 2023

The city of Mill Creek, Washington, will be having a Veterans Day Ceremony and Parade Friday, November 10, 2023. Mustangs Northwest will have some classic Mustangs in the parade. If you have a classic Mustang and want to be in the parade contact Ron Foster (vp@mustangsnorthwest.com) by October 25th.

Congratulations to PNWMustangs Fall Car Show Winners

Congratulations to the members of Mustangs Northwest that received awards at the Fall Car Show hosted by Pacific Northwest Mustangs Club. The Fall Car Show is one of the last car shows of the year. It took place this year on October 1st at the Wine Village near Prosser, Washington.
